Lines Matching refs:s_size
66 Py_ssize_t s_size;
1377 self->s_size = size;
1450 s->s_size = -1;
1589 if (buffer->len != self->s_size) {
1592 self->s_size);
1623 if (offset + self->s_size > 0) {
1626 self->s_size,
1641 if ((buffer->len - offset) < self->s_size) {
1646 (size_t)self->s_size + (size_t)offset,
1647 self->s_size,
1694 len = (self->buf.len - self->index) / self->so->s_size;
1716 assert(self->index + self->so->s_size <= self->buf.len);
1720 self->index += self->so->s_size;
1772 if (self->s_size == 0) {
1786 if (iter->buf.len % self->s_size != 0) {
1790 self->s_size);
1820 memset(buf, '\0', soself->s_size);
1920 buf = _PyBytesWriter_Alloc(&writer, soself->s_size);
1932 return _PyBytesWriter_Finish(&writer, buf + soself->s_size);
1988 if (offset + soself->s_size > 0) {
1991 soself->s_size,
2011 if ((buffer.len - offset) < soself->s_size) {
2013 assert(soself->s_size >= 0);
2019 (size_t)soself->s_size + (size_t)offset,
2020 soself->s_size,
2047 return PyLong_FromSsize_t(self->s_size);
2193 return s_object->s_size;